When drafting an application for a subsidy on a tractor, it's important to maintain clarity and politeness. Clearly state your name, address, and intention to apply for the subsidy. Specify details about the tractor you intend to purchase, such as its purpose and cost. Express your interest in learning about the scheme's benefits, funding options, application procedure, and other key details. Avoid using unclear language and ensure all necessary details are included to facilitate a smooth application process.

Sample Application for tractor subsidy information
To,
The ___________ (Concerned Authority),
___________ (Government Department),
___________ (Address)
Date: __/__/____ (Date)
Subject: Application for tractor subsidy information
Respected Sir/ Madam,
I am __________ (Name) and I am a resident of _____________ (Location).
I intend to avail your guidance and benefits of ____________ (Scheme name) scheme. I want to buy a tractor for ____________ (Purpose) purpose and as per the scheme I am entitled to the benefits provided by the Government. The total cost of the tractor is ____________ (Amount). I am writing this letter to seek your assistance with the scheme which includes, the benefits of this scheme, initial funding, the procedure for availing of this scheme, and all other key benefits. I shall be highly served for your kind support.
I am enclosing _____________ (Quotation/Invoice of the tractor – Mention other documents). It will be kind of yours if you could mail me at ___________@______._____ (Email- ID) or ___________ (Contact Number).
Thanking You,
____________ (Signature),
____________ (Name),
____________ (Contact Number)

FAQs
- Q: How can I apply for a subsidy on a tractor?
- A: To apply for a subsidy on a tractor, you typically need to contact the concerned government department or authority responsible for administering the subsidy scheme. You may need to fill out an application form and provide relevant documentation.
- Q: What information should I include in my tractor subsidy application?
- A: In your application, include details such as your name, address, contact information, purpose for purchasing the tractor, total cost of the tractor, and any supporting documents such as quotations or invoices.
- Q: What are the benefits of the tractor subsidy scheme?
- A: The benefits of the tractor subsidy scheme may include financial assistance, reduced initial costs for purchasing a tractor, and support for agricultural or other related activities.
- Q: How long does it take to process a tractor subsidy application?
- A: The processing time for a tractor subsidy application can vary depending on the government department or authority administering the scheme and the volume of applications received. It's advisable to inquire about the expected timeline during the application process.
- Q: What documents may be required for a tractor subsidy application?
- A: Documents commonly required for a tractor subsidy application may include proof of identity, proof of residence, tractor quotation or invoice, and any other documentation specified by the subsidy scheme guidelines.
